Thailand imposes burning ban to curb PM2.5 pollution

The government has announced a “no-burn” measure in a bid to control air pollution, with punishment lined up for violators.

Thailand Tightens PM2.5 Dust Controls

Government spokesman Jirayu Houngsub said the ban follows a forecast of stagnant air circulation that will last until Feb 3, worsening the PM2.5 situation.
